🥘 Ingredients

7 items
  • 4 large Egg whites
  • 100 grams Gran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 500 milliliters Whole milk
  • 150 grams Dark chocolate (70% cocoa)
  • 100 milliliters Heavy cream
  • 1 tablespoon Powdered sugar

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Separate the egg whites from the yolks and place the whites in a clean, dry mixing bowl.

2

Using an electric mixer or whisk, beat the egg whites until soft peaks form. Gradually add the granulated sugar, one tablespoon at a time, while continuing to whisk until the mixture is glossy and stiff peaks form.

3

Gently fold in the vanilla extract until just combined.

4

Heat the milk in a wide, shallow saucepan over medium-low heat until it is steaming but not boiling.

5

Using two large spoons, form oval-shaped meringue quenelles by scooping and shaping the beaten egg whites. Gently lower each quenelle into the steaming milk.

6

Poach the meringue quenelles for 1–2 minutes on each side, turning carefully. Remove them with a slotted spoon and transfer to a plate lined with paper towels to drain.

7

For the chocolate sauce, heat the heavy cream in a small saucepan over medium heat until it starts to simmer. Remove from heat and add the dark chocolate, stirring until smooth and fully melted.

8

To serve, pour a generous amount of chocolate sauce into shallow bowls. Gently place the poached meringue quenelles on top of the sauce.

9

Dust with powdered sugar for garnish and serve immediately. Enjoy!
